About the role

We are seeking an Instrument Support Electrical Engineer to support the High Flux Isotope Reactor (HFIR) neutron scattering instruments and associated infrastructure.

Major Duties/Responsibilities

  • Design and develop electrical systems — panel layouts, wiring schematics, cable assemblies, and equipment specifications.
  • Troubleshoot and diagnose electrical cabinets, power distribution systems, circuit boards, and embedded control hardware to ensure compliant, reliable field installations.
  • Evaluate electrical hardware and verify sizing, load ratings, and calculations against applicable codes and standards (NEC, UL).
  • Develop and maintain technical documentation, including electrical drawings, schematics, test plans, and work instructions.
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to execute work in compliance with HFIR Neutron Scattering work control, configuration management, and safety requirements.

Basic Qualifications

  • A BS degree in electrical engineering, electrical engineering technology, or a related field.
  • A minimum of 5 years of experience in electrical power distribution design, panel layout, or industrial/facility electrical systems, including field troubleshooting and installation.
  • Working knowledge of electrical engineering principles, electrical codes, and applicable industry standards.
  • Experience interpreting and developing electrical drawings and technical documentation.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ience supporting industrial, research, laboratory, or facility electrical systems.
  • Experience supporting electrical design and construction projects.
  • Knowledge of power distribution systems and power electronics.
  • Experience troubleshooting electrical or electronic systems using standard laboratory or diagnostic equipment.
  • Proficiency with AutoCAD or similar drafting/design software.
  • Familiarity with DOE laboratory environments, nuclear facilities, or regulated technical operations.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ills with the ability to work effectively in multidisciplinary teams.
